Bitcoin ETF Inflows Surge

On April 6, 2026, spot bitcoin exchange-traded funds (ETFs) experienced an inflow of $471 million. This represents the sixth-largest daily inflow for the year and the most substantial since late February [1][2]. The notable increase in inflow is occurring as market participants predict limited immediate action from the Federal Reserve regarding interest rate adjustments [1].

Broader Cryptocurrency Market Conditions

The surge in bitcoin ETF investments comes amid a broader context of ongoing fluctuations within the cryptocurrency market. As of the current data, Bitcoin, the leading cryptocurrency by market capitalization, is valued at $68,635, experiencing a 1.72% decrease in value over the past 24 hours [1]. Ethereum, another significant player, is priced at $2,094.77, with an observed decline of 2.31% over the same period [2].

Resurgence in Ether Funds

In tandem with the bitcoin ETF inflow surge, Ether funds have returned to gaining after previously displayed cautious market sentiment [2]. This shift indicates a renewed investor interest and confidence despite the cautious stance in broader market trends [2].
